Polly Britten: Gender Equity Advocate in Skilled Trades

Take a break, we’re on Smoko. This week, we’re joined by Polly Britten, 2023 Churchill Fellow and passionate advocate for women in skilled trades. Polly dives into her extensive research on how to make trades education more inclusive for women and non-binary youth—and how early, intentional change can transform the industry.

Her work, developed through her fellowship and the NextGen Tradies - Try a Trade Program, offers a roadmap for creating equitable pathways into skilled trades. From integrating exposure at the school level to shifting leadership culture, Polly lays out practical solutions for educators, policymakers, and employers alike.

“The biggest change starts with recognizing unconscious bias and actively working to break stereotypes at every level—from daycare to industry leadership.” – Polly Britten

We discuss the importance of mentorship, authentic representation, and cross-cultural learning—highlighting leading programs and organizations from Australia, Canada, Germany, and Denmark that are helping close the gender gap in trades.
